A Town of Lockport man was charged early Saturday morning after he allegedly fled a traffic stop and led sheriff’s deputies on a pursuit that ended on foot.
Christopher R. Boyd, 21, is charged with reckless driving and third-degree unlawful fleeing a police officer in a motor vehicle, according to the Niagara County Sheriff’s Office.ย He was released on an appearance ticket.
The pursuit started at 12:36 a.m. Saturday when a sheriff’s deputy noticed a vehicle driving without its headlights on, the Sheriff’s Office said. When the deputy attempted to pull the vehicle over, the vehicle fled and led the deputy on a pursuit through the city and town of Lockport.
The vehicle, operated by Boyd, pulled into an address on Dysinger Road before Boyd and his passenger fled on foot.
Both were detained after a brief pursuit on foot.
